Chinanews.com, December 6th. According to the website of the Macao SAR Government, the Macao Novel Coronavirus Infection Response Coordination Center (hereinafter referred to as the Response Coordination Center) stated that in order to balance the needs of epidemic prevention and control and personnel exchanges, the mainland will be optimized from December 6. Anti-epidemic measures for people entering Macau. People returning to Macau from low-risk areas in the Mainland and normalized epidemic prevention and control areas are not required to undergo centralized isolation medical observation, but the requirements for nucleic acid testing and antigen testing have been strengthened.

People who come to Australia from high-risk areas in the Mainland still need to undergo medical observation.

  At the same time, the Response Coordination Center no longer announces the risk areas in the Mainland, and instead depends on the announcement on the website of the National Health Commission or the State Council's client-side applet.

  The Macao Health Bureau issued an announcement in accordance with the relevant laws and regulations. Starting from 00:00 on December 6, the epidemic prevention measures for people who intend to enter the country and those who have already entered the country (including Macao residents and non-Macao residents) with a travel history in different risk areas in the Mainland will be adjusted as follows:

  1. Those who intend to enter the country and have already entered the country with a history of living in high-risk areas in Mainland China on the same day or in the past 5 days will maintain the "5+3" measures, that is, 5 days of centralized isolation and 3 days of home isolation.

  2. Measures for those who intend to enter the country and those who have already entered the country who have a history of living in low-risk areas in Mainland China on the same day or in the past 5 days are as follows:

  (1) When boarding a plane, boarding a ship or entering the country through a land port, a certificate of negative nucleic acid test within 24 hours after the sampling day and a rapid antigen test within 6 hours are required. The result is negative and the result has been uploaded to the Macao Health Code;

  (2) Nucleic acid tests must be carried out on the 1st, 2nd, 3rd, and 5th days after entering or becoming aware of the relevant risks, with at least 12 hours between samples for each nucleic acid test.

Measures until 5 days from the day after leaving the low-risk area or leaving the country;

  (3) From the day after entering the country or becoming aware of the relevant risks, a rapid antigen test must be carried out once a day for 5 consecutive days, and the results should be uploaded to the Macao Health Code.

Measures until 5 days from the day after leaving the low-risk area or leaving the country;

  For example: when entering Macau on Monday, nucleic acid testing and rapid antigen testing are required on Tuesday, Wednesday, Thursday, and Saturday, and rapid antigen testing is only required on Friday, and verification inspection is not required; if you leave the country on Thursday, the measures will be implemented until Thursday until.

  3. The measures for those who have only lived in the normal management area and directly entered the country from the mainland other than Zhuhai City, Guangdong Province are as follows:

  (1) When entering the country, you must hold a negative nucleic acid test certificate within 48 hours after the sampling date (this requirement will come into effect at 00:00 on December 7) and a rapid antigen test within 6 hours. The result is negative and the result has been uploaded to Macau Health Code;

  (2) Receive a free nucleic acid test immediately after entering the country, and receive a nucleic acid test on the first and second days after the day of entry, with at least 12 hours between each nucleic acid test;

  (3) From the next day of entry, a rapid antigen test must be carried out once a day for 5 consecutive days, and the results shall be uploaded to the Macao Health Code.

Measures can be terminated after departure.

  For example: a free nucleic acid test is performed immediately after entering Macau on Monday, nucleic acid test and rapid antigen test are required on Tuesday and Wednesday, and rapid antigen test is performed on Thursday, Friday and Saturday; if you leave the country on Thursday, the measures will be implemented until Thursday until.

  4. The measures for those who only have a residence history in the normal management area and enter the country through Zhuhai City, Guangdong Province are as follows:

  (1) When entering the country, a negative nucleic acid test certificate must be presented on or within 24 hours after the sampling day.

  (2) A nucleic acid test shall be carried out on the first and second days after the day of entry, and the interval between each nucleic acid test shall be at least 12 hours;

  (3) People who live in hotels or apartment-style hotels after entering the country must take a rapid antigen test once a day for 5 consecutive days from the day after entering the country, and upload the results to the Macao Health Code.

Measures can be terminated after departure.

  For example, if you enter Macau on Monday, you need to undergo nucleic acid testing on Tuesday and Wednesday. If you live in a hotel after entering Macau, you must also undergo rapid antigen testing on Tuesday, Wednesday, Thursday, Friday, and Saturday; if you leave the country on Thursday, the measures will be implemented until Thursday.

  The Response Coordination Center also reminded that if nucleic acid testing and sampling are not carried out on the designated date, the Macau Health Code will turn yellow the next day, and those who have not been tested for nucleic acid within the day of the yellow code will have their Macau Health Code turn red.

If you do not declare the results of the rapid antigen test by the specified date, the Macau Health Code will change to a yellow code on the next day. If you declare the rapid antigen test results on the day of the yellow code, the Macau Health Code can be converted back to the green code. Otherwise, the Macau Health Code will be locked with a yellow code , You must undergo a nucleic acid test at your own expense to change back to the green code.
